As reviewed in Hot for chocolate July 27, 2004, The Age, Epicure:
Hot chocolate (with optional frog), $2.80
Hahndorf's Fine Chocolates, Elwood
Hahndorf's German chocolate making traditions have certainly extended to their hot-chocolate making. Our glass of liquid bliss was carefully prepared using a handmade chocolate frog (optional) that was slowly melted with hot milk and topped with a frothy mound of chocolate shavings. For choc-coffee addicts, Hahndorf's contemporary take on the mocha (or chocolatte) is equally splendid. Both include a complimentary, handmade chocolate cream or truffle of your choice. - Liz Cincotta
